The Depth
Filtration Market comprises technologies and media designed to capture
particulate contaminants within the depth of the filter medium rather than on
its surface. This mechanism is widely used in applications requiring the
removal of contaminants from liquids and gases with a high particulate load.
Key factors
driving demand for depth filtration solutions include:
- Cost-effectiveness: Depth filters offer a lower
operational cost compared to membrane filters, especially in large-scale
industrial applications.
- Ease of implementation: Their simple design and
compatibility with existing infrastructure make them ideal for diverse
sectors.
- Extended shelf life and
reliability:
With strong contaminant-holding capacity and reduced clogging risks, depth
filters ensure longer operational cycles and reduced downtime.
In
biotechnology and biopharma, these filters are crucial for cell clarification
and pre-filtration before final sterile filtration. Similarly, in the food
& beverage industry, depth filters are valued for preserving the flavor and
quality of sensitive liquids like wine, beer, and juices.

Depth
Filtration Market: Segment Analysis
By
Product:
- Cartridge Filters:
Widely used for fine particle filtration and clarification in
pharmaceutical and water purification applications due to their structural
strength and versatility.
- Capsule Filters:
Preferred in small-scale and lab-scale filtration, these are
self-contained and reduce contamination risks, making them ideal for
sensitive biological fluids.
- Filter Sheets:
Traditional yet effective for coarse and polishing filtration, especially
in beverage manufacturing and batch processing systems.
- Filter Modules:
Integrated filter solutions are gaining popularity for large-scale
continuous operations, especially in downstream bioprocessing setups.
By
Media:
- Diatomaceous Earth (DE): Highly effective in removing fine particles, DE-based
media are prominent in the beverage and water treatment sectors due to
their large surface area.
- Cellulose:
Natural and biodegradable, cellulose-based filters are favored in
pharmaceutical and food industries for their compatibility with organic
fluids.
- Perlite:
Known for its lightweight and high contaminant-holding capacity, perlite
is used in cost-sensitive and high-volume applications.
- Activated Carbon:
Used primarily for removing odor, color, and organic contaminants,
activated carbon filters find applications in both industrial processes
and water purification.
By
End Use:
- Biopharmaceuticals:
The dominant end-use segment, driven by the need for sterile, high-purity
processes in vaccine, antibody, and protein production.
- Downstream Processing: Depth filters are essential in removing host cell
proteins and particulates before final sterile filtration.
- Cell Clarification:
Used early in the purification process to remove whole cells and cell
debris, improving yield and process efficiency.
- Food & Beverage:
Essential for achieving clarity, stability, and microbial safety in
liquids like wine, beer, and fruit juices.
- Water Treatment:
Provides a cost-effective solution for pretreatment and polishing
filtration in municipal and industrial water systems.
- Industrial Processes:
Used across chemicals, petrochemicals, and coatings industries for
maintaining process fluid purity and equipment protection.
